Cornus alternifolia

https://www.denolf.com/web/image/plant.info/9670/image_1920?unique=18408d0

The Cornus alternifolia 'Argentea' is a large, spreading deciduous shrub with branches bearing ovate, white-margined leaves. It also has small white flowers. Small, round fruits ripen to a deep blue-purple in late summer. Grow in moist soil in partial shade.
